1樓:仰丹丹
#include
using namespace std;
enum cpu_rank ;
class cpu
private:
cpu_rank rank;
int frequency;
float voltage;
public:
cpu(int newrank,int newfrequency,float newvoltage);
void run();
void stop();
~cpu(){cout<<"成功呼叫析構函式" cout<<"程式開始執行" cout<<"程式結束" rank=(cpu_rank)newrank; frequency=newfrequency; voltage=newvoltage; cout<<"成功呼叫建構函式" cpu cpu(2,60,220); cpu.run(); cpu.stop(); return 0; 執行結果 2樓:匿名使用者 class cpu ;float run(); float stop(); ~cpu();} c++類**的輸入 3樓:穩住大神 #include using namespace std; enum cpu_rank ; class cpu {private: cpu_rank rank; int frequency; float voltage; public: cpu(cpu_rank ran, int f, float v){rank = ran; frequency = f; voltage = v; cout<<"我是構造"< c++題目,由於對列舉不是很會,學習的時老師也沒講清楚,所以這題部分程式寫不出來,請教高手~~ 4樓: #include "iostream.h" enum cpu_rank ;class cpu ;cpu::cpu(void) cpu::~cpu(void) void cpu::run() void cpu::stop() int main(void) 把上面的程式執行一下,就可以看到執行流程-- 5樓:匿名使用者 enum cpu_rank ;#pragma once class cpu ;#include "stdafx.h" #include "pu.h" cpu::cpu(void) cpu::~cpu(void) void cpu::run() void cpu::stop() 先執行建構函式,然後在執行成員函式,最後執行析構函式。 定義乙個cpu類,包含等級,頻率 6樓:你猜我猜哇擦猜 3)),ram(20),cdram(30) computer::computer(cpu c,ram r,cdram cd):cpu(c),ram(r),cdram(cd) computer:: ram),cdram(p.cdram) void main() 幫忙看一下這個關於」類與物件」的c++program是什麼意思.謝謝. 7樓:匿名使用者 那幾行字啊??? 你這程式就編了這麼點, 應該只會輸出: 構造了乙個cpu! cpu開始執行 cpu停止執行 析構了乙個cpu! 你編的程式一共就這麼幾個輸出的地方,你就算全呼叫了一遍,也只有這幾個輸出 c++問題 定義乙個cpu類 8樓:柳生十連兵 1,2,3,4,5,6項在windows api中可以找到函式,但是你確定可以讓cpu停止工作? 如果你沒弄明白這個就要好好看看書了。不懂類的話幹嗎非要用類呢?可以用結構體啊。將資料成員private的目的就是保護資料不被呼叫,不能隨便改寫。在main函式中,通過new,分配記憶體空間,然後呼叫建構函式進行賦值,比如你的這個函式 stud long num,char name,char kc,f... 簡單的方法就是用到繼承,記住的概念 子類繼承父類的方法和變數,則這些方法和變數就屬於子類,則子類物件對這些方法和變數 的呼叫是顯而易見的,舉個例子為了省事就不給您寫出包名直接從累寫起class test class a class b extends a 最後輸出結果就是 1super.x 1 1x... using system public class desk 基類desk 設定desk的資訊 public void setinfo int len,int wid,int hei 列印desk的引數資訊 public void showinfo t width t height length,w...C 定義學生類包含學生學號,姓名,成績,課程資訊,以及平均成績
定義了類A又定義了類B,類B的成員函式的定義用到了類A的
c中怎麼定義類,c 中怎麼定義一個類